3 Things You Need to Know Before Buying Solar Panels

There’s no questioning the environmental benefits of installing a solar panel system. Harnessing the free energy the sun abundantly gives all year round for decades will certainly do mother nature a favor, especially considering climate change’s menacing effects.

However, you might not get excellent results from your investment, financially speaking, if you don’t take the things that matter most into consideration. Not Every Roof Lends Itself to Solar Panel Installation
The roof isn’t just the natural spot to put a solar panel system; it’s also the best with its direct exposure to the sun. But then again, not all roofs make a good foundation to collect solar power. Some are covered in shade most of the year, while others become obstructed over time with foliage.
Further, not all roof designs are conducive to solar installation. By and large, flat roofs are the best because their minimal pitch makes the process less tricky.
It Can’t Move the Needle in Energy Savings on Its Own
Yes, a solar panel system can generate free energy you can use as an alternative to electricity. But then again, it won’t make a lot of difference if you haven’t done anything else to boost your home’s energy efficiency. If you can’t produce more energy than you consume, or at least most of what you currently use, the benefits of investing in a solar home energy system would be diminished.
Some States Make Net Metering Less Attractive
One of the best ways to recoup the cost of installing grid-connected solar panels is net metering. This is when you can be credited for the excess energy you generate. Most of your potential reimbursement depends on where you live. Although the rewards of solar panel installation are old news, many states still haven’t adopt policies where utilities pay for surplus energy.
Fortunately, the Golden State is one of the few that scored an A on Interstate Renewal Energy Council’s “Freeing the Grid” scorecard. In other words, the latest legislation promotes net metering, incentivizing ordinary homeowners to invest in solar.
